Why Ultrasound Thermal Paper Selection Matters
Ultrasound printers are designed to work with specific thermal paper grades. Using the correct paper ensures:
- Consistent image contrast and clarity
- Accurate grayscale reproduction
- Reduced printer wear
- Reliable long-term storage of printed images
Choosing the wrong paper type may result in poor image quality or inconsistent output.
Common Ultrasound Thermal Paper Grades Explained
Durico ultrasound thermal paper is available in multiple grades to support different imaging needs.
Standard (S) Grade
Standard thermal paper is designed for routine ultrasound printing where consistent performance and cost efficiency are priorities.
Clinics commonly use standard paper for:
- Daily imaging workflows
- General documentation
- High-volume printing

High-Gloss (HG) Grade
High-gloss thermal paper provides increased contrast and sharper image presentation compared to standard grade paper.
Clinics may prefer high-gloss paper for:
- Enhanced visual clarity
- Improved image presentation
- Situations where detail visibility is important

High-Density (HD) Grade
High-density thermal paper is designed for premium imaging environments that require maximum grayscale depth and image density.
Clinics typically use high-density paper for:
- Advanced diagnostic imaging
- Detailed ultrasound output
- Applications requiring the highest image fidelity

OEM Paper Equivalents (Common Reference)
Many clinics identify thermal paper by OEM product names currently used in their printers. Below is a common reference:
| OEM Paper Reference | Durico Equivalent |
|---|---|
| Sony UPP-110S (Type I) | Durico 1100S — 110mm × 20m |
| Sony UPP-110HG (Type V) | Durico 1100HG — 110mm × 18m |
| Sony UPP-110HD (Type II) | Durico ULSTAR-1100HD — 110mm × 20m |
| Sony UPP-210HD (Type II) | Durico ULSTAR-2100HD — 210mm × 25m |
| Mitsubishi K95H / K91HG / KP91HG | Durico 1100HG — 110mm × 18m |
Always confirm printer compatibility and paper type settings before switching products.
Printer Compatibility & Settings
Our 110mm grades — 1100HG, ULSTAR-1100HD and 1100S — fit the Sony UP-895 / 897 / 898 Series. The 210mm ULSTAR-2100HD fits the Sony UP-970 / 971 / 990 / 991AD.
For Mitsubishi P93 / P95 printers, the 1100HG is the only grade we stock that fits — the 1100HD, 1100S and 2100HD are Sony-only.
For best results, printer paper settings should match the paper grade:
- Standard (S) → Durico 1100S
- High-Gloss (HG) → Durico 1100HG
- High-Density (HD), 110mm → Durico ULSTAR-1100HD
- High-Density (HD), 210mm → Durico ULSTAR-2100HD
